Is that true though? Many of the core LLMs need to be retrained as languages evolve to incorporate changes (language specifics, compilers, tooling, etc.). To some degree this can be handled via context injection in a variety do forms (agents looking up documentation and so on) but inevitably it’s not stationary in time, just as your OSS stack (probably) isn’t (depending on the languages, technologies, and use cases).
So your hardware is to some degree dependent on the good merit of groups like Z or Alibaba or whomever pushing out updated open weight models that dumped loads of capital into to train. You can keep using the existing models but at some point I suspect they’ll start to have more friction due to dated specs in language and so on. Again there are tuning and ways of layering this information on, and in theory you can even do some training on your own but I don’t think it’s as stationary as being portrayed here.
Those updated open weight models may not always be there (updated on new data). The usability of them is probably fairly long to be fair, but I suspect you’re going to see explosion in everything from libraries to languages etc due to LLMs so even the rate of change across your OSS stack may cause these models to be dated quite quickly, at least in the core model which will require layering fixes.
